Connecter un routeur sans fil via la ligne de commande Ubuntu

1

Je souhaite me connecter à mon routeur sans fil TP_Link via une ligne de commande (à partir d'un serveur Ubuntu). J'essaye avec ça:

ifconfig wlan0 down
iwconfig wlan0 essid {MY ESSID}
iwconfig wlan0 key s:{PASSWORD}
ifconfig wlan0 up

À ce stade, la sortie de mon iwconfig wlan0 est satisfaisante, puis je demande une adresse IP au serveur DHCP du PA:

dhclient -r
dhclient wlan0

Cette dernière commande est suspendue pendant 2-3 minutes, puis se ferme sans aucune sortie. Le iwconfig wlan0 produit la même chose, toujours "Point d'accès: non associé" On dirait que je ne peux pas obtenir d'adresse IP.

Quelqu'un peut-il aider quel est le problème?

RobbeR
la source

Réponses:

0

Pardon iwconfig ne fonctionne que pour le cryptage WEP.

veuillez utiliser le wpa_supplicant


éditer le /etc/wpa_supplicant.conf fichier en utilisant gedit ou vim ou ce que vous préférez.

ajouter à la fin du fichier

network={
    ssid="my network"
    scan_ssid=1 //this must be added if the AP doesnt broadcast its ssid
    psk="sekret"
}

alors vous pouvez activer manuellement le demandeur

# wpa_supplicant -B -i interface -c /etc/wpa_supplicant.conf

une fois connecté, vous pouvez obtenir une adresse via DHCP avec

# dhcpd interface
Bryan Cerrati
la source
Mec, tu es une bouée de sauvetage. Merci, wpa_supplicant fonctionne à merveille
RobbeR
de rien. :-)
Bryan Cerrati